SQL, ou Structured Query Language, est un langage de programmation standard utilisé pour communiquer avec et manipuler des bases de données relationnelles. Il est largement utilisé dans le domaine de la gestion de bases de données et est essentiel pour stocker, récupérer, modifier et supprimer des données.


1. Qu'est-ce que SQL ?


SQL est un langage déclaratif, ce qui signifie que vous lui dites ce que vous voulez accomplir plutôt que de lui dire comment le faire. Avec SQL, vous pouvez effectuer différentes opérations sur les données, telles que l'insertion, la mise à jour, la suppression et la récupération.


2. Pourquoi SQL est-il important ?


SQL est crucial car il permet aux utilisateurs d'interagir avec les bases de données de manière efficace et cohérente. Voici quelques raisons pour lesquelles SQL est important :


  • Gestion des Données : SQL permet de stocker des données de manière structurée dans des bases de données, facilitant ainsi la gestion et l'organisation des informations.
  • Interrogation des Données : SQL permet d'extraire des données spécifiques selon des critères définis à l'aide de requêtes, ce qui facilite l'analyse et la récupération d'informations pertinentes.
  • Modification des Données : SQL permet de mettre à jour, d'insérer et de supprimer des données, ce qui permet de maintenir les bases de données à jour et précises.


3. Les Principales Catégories de Commandes SQL


SQL est divisé en plusieurs catégories de commandes, chacune ayant un objectif spécifique :


  • DDL (Data Definition Language) : Ces commandes sont utilisées pour définir la structure de la base de données, telles que la création, la modification et la suppression de tables. Exemples : CREATE TABLE, ALTER TABLE, DROP TABLE.
  • DML (Data Manipulation Language) : Ces commandes sont utilisées pour manipuler les données elles-mêmes, telles que l'insertion, la mise à jour, la suppression et la récupération des données. Exemples : INSERT INTO, UPDATE, DELETE, SELECT.
  • DCL (Data Control Language) : Ces commandes sont utilisées pour gérer les autorisations et les permissions sur la base de données, telles que l'octroi et la révocation de privilèges. Exemples : GRANT, REVOKE.
  • TCL (Transaction Control Language) : Ces commandes sont utilisées pour gérer les transactions dans la base de données, telles que le début, la validation et l'annulation des transactions. Exemples : BEGIN TRANSACTION, COMMIT, ROLLBACK.


4. Exemple de Requête SQL


Voici un exemple simple de requête SQL pour récupérer toutes les informations d'une table nommée "utilisateurs" :


SELECT * FROM utilisateurs;


Cette requête sélectionne toutes les colonnes (*) de la table "utilisateurs" et renvoie toutes les lignes de la table.


Ce cours introductif vous donne un aperçu de base de SQL, de son importance et des principales catégories de commandes. En comprenant ces concepts, vous serez prêt à explorer davantage et à apprendre à utiliser SQL pour interagir avec les bases de données

3133 vues
Modifié le 26 mars 2024
Publicité Sitedudev
Cette pub permet au site de vivre ...
Publicité
Cette pub permet au site de vivre ...
Voir d'autres articles
2 333 vues
Installer SASS sur votre système
Installation de SASS sur votre système1. Installer Node.js :SASS nécessite Node.js pour fonctionner. Si vous ne l'avez pas déjà installé, téléchargez et installez Node.js à partir du site...
Sass
3 821 vues
Afficher les commentaires
Nous allons reprendre notre page topic.php. Sur cette page nous allons afficher les commentaires postés de vos utilisateur.Dans notre page topic.php nous allons donc afficher les...
Créer son site
508 vues
Syntaxe des Directives
Chaque directive dans le fichier .htaccess suit une syntaxe spécifique pour fonctionner correctement. Comprendre cette syntaxe est essentiel pour utiliser efficacement les directives dans votre...
HTACCESS
18 013 vues
Se connecter à une base de données en PHP
La première étape avant de se lancer dans la conception de son site et de créer une connexion directe avec sa base de données si vous avez besoin de stocker des données par la suite.Nous allons...
Créer son site
14 043 vues
Notre base de données
Avant d'entamer le développement de notre futur site il nous faut une base de données afin de pouvoir ajouter, modifier ou de supprimer des informations.Étapes...
Créer son site
5 694 vues
Créer son blog
Développer son Blog de A à ZAprès avoir terminer les articles pour développer votre Forum de A à Z maintenant nous allons nous attaquer à la création d'un blog complet !Pour...
Créer son site
4 074 vues
Créer un topic
Créer un topicDans notre dossier **f_forum**, nous allons créer une nouvelle page creer_topic.php. Cette page permettra à vos utilisateurs de pouvoir créer un topic afin de demande de l'aide,...
Créer son site
4 265 vues
Créer un article
Créer un articleNous allons créer une nouvelle page que l'on nommera creer_article.php. Cette page permettra de créer un article qui sera visible sur le blog.Nous allons modifier notre...
Créer son site
Publicité
Cette pub permet au site de vivre ...